Role overview

In this role, you will be responsible for pricing, reimbursement, and market access strategy and execution in Sweden. You will leverage your expertise in the healthcare and payer landscape to shape access strategies that enable optimal patient access.

Acting as a strategic partner across cross-functional teams, you will translate complex clinical and economic evidence into clear, actionable insights that support decision-making and value communication. As the primary PRA contact toward national stakeholders, you will lead reimbursement dossiers, HTA materials, and key access initiatives aligned with Swedish national objectives.

Key responsibilities

  • Develop and implement pricing, reimbursement, and market access strategies in Sweden
  • Lead reimbursement submissions and three-party negotiations with payers
  • Adapt global access strategies to the Swedish market, including localization of dossiers and value materials
  • Drive dossier preparation and coordinate the full HTA process and key milestones
  • Act as the key PRA contact for assigned oncology/hematology products
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with authorities, clinical experts, and key opinion leaders
  • Collaborate with Nordic and global market access, pricing, and health economics teams
  • Monitor and analyze external changes (policy, competitors, market dynamics)
